What is a Texas Trailer Bill of Sale form?
The Texas Trailer Bill of Sale form is a legal document used to record the sale of a trailer in the state of Texas. This form serves as proof of the transaction between the seller and the buyer. It includes essential details about the trailer, such as its make, model, year, and Vehicle Identification Number (VIN), along with the names and addresses of both parties involved in the sale.
Why do I need a Bill of Sale for a trailer?
A Bill of Sale is important for several reasons. It provides legal protection for both the buyer and the seller by documenting the terms of the sale. This document can help resolve disputes that may arise in the future regarding ownership or the condition of the trailer. Additionally, it is often required when registering the trailer with the Texas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V).
What information is required on the form?
The Texas Trailer Bill of Sale form typically requires the following information: the names and addresses of the buyer and seller, the trailer's make, model, year, and VIN, the sale price, and the date of the transaction. Both parties may also sign the document to confirm their agreement to the sale.
Is the Bill of Sale required to register a trailer in Texas?
Yes, a Bill of Sale is generally required to register a trailer in Texas. When you go to the DMV to register the trailer, you will need to present the Bill of Sale along with any other required documents, such as proof of ownership or identification. This ensures that the trailer is legally recognized under the new owner's name.
Can I create my own Bill of Sale for a trailer?
While you can create your own Bill of Sale, it is advisable to use a standardized form to ensure that all necessary information is included. Standard forms are often designed to meet legal requirements and provide clarity for both parties. Many templates are available online, and you can customize them to fit your specific transaction.
What if the trailer has a lien against it?
If there is a lien on the trailer, the seller must disclose this information to the buyer. The buyer should be aware that a lien indicates that the trailer is still under financial obligation. It is advisable for the buyer to obtain a lien release from the seller before completing the sale to ensure clear ownership and avoid future complications.
Do I need to have the Bill of Sale notarized?
Notarization is not typically required for a Texas Trailer Bill of Sale, but it can add an extra layer of security and authenticity to the document. Having the Bill of Sale notarized can help prevent disputes regarding the transaction in the future, as it provides a verified record of the agreement between the parties.
